adj. 1. Excellent or exceptionally good: an outstanding essay that received an A+. 2. Noticeable or conspicuous: "Thiamine deficiency alone generally produces peripheral neuritis and numbness as its most outstanding features" (Vernon H. Mark). 3. Still in existence; not settled or resolved: outstanding debts; a long outstanding problem. 4. Publicly issued and sold: outstanding shares of stock. out·standing·ly adv. |
